Remains of Missing Hanson Woman Identified

by | May 5, 2026 | News

Sandra Crispo Has Been Missing for 7 Years

The human remains found along route 3 in Plymouth back in March have been identified as that of a missing Hanson woman

Plymouth County District Attorney Tim Cruz said yesterday Tuesday the remains are of Sandra Crispo who disappeared in August 2019.

Crispo was 54 when she was reported missing by her family after they were unable to reach her at her Spofford Avenue home in Hanson.

Since her disappearance, Cruz said that an extensive investigation has been conducted.

Authorities say a hunter found the remains in March 2025 between exits 13 and 14 on Route 3 north in Plymouth.

The FBI conducted DNA tests and confirmed it was Crispo.

Plymouth County District Attorney Tim Cruz says the investigation is ongoing and is asking anyone with information to contact his office at 508-894-2600 or Hanson Police at 781-293-4625.
